Hozier Marks 10 Years of Iconic Debut Album with Exclusive Vinyl & Festival Headline

Vinyl enthusiasts, brace yourselves. Hozier is commemorating the 10th anniversary of his self-titled debut album with an exclusive reissue set to release on May 16th via Island Records.

This isn’t just any anniversary; it’s a tribute to an album that transformed the music scene and became a cultural touchstone.

Ten Years Later, “Take Me to Church” is Still Commanding Attention

When Hozier’s Take Me to Church hit the airwaves, it resonated far beyond charts and playlists—it touched nerves, started conversations, and solidified its creator as a powerful voice.

Certified Diamond in the US and seven times Platinum in the UK, this anthem was only the beginning.

The album also delivered hits like Work Song, From Eden, and Someone New, each holding a unique place in listeners’ memories and playlists.

Exclusive Vinyl Editions Worth Fighting Over

Hozier isn’t holding back on this vinyl celebration, offering multiple versions to spark envy among collectors.

From the double-LP custard yellow to the limited-edition baby blue available exclusively through his website, each variant feels personal and collectible.

US Amazon buyers have a striking olive-green edition, while Irish fans get an exclusive evergreen vinyl.

Adding extra allure, bonus tracks “In The Woods Somewhere, Run, Arsonist’s Lullabye, and My Love Will Never Die will appear on vinyl for the first time.

Massive Tours and Headline Festival Performances

This summer, Hozier brings his celebrated live performance to fans across North and South America with extensive arena tours starting in May.

UK fans can catch him headlining the Reading and Leeds Festivals on August 22nd and 23rd—events guaranteed to be unforgettable and emotional for attendees.

Building Momentum from Debut Success to Recent Triumphs

Hozier has continuously elevated his artistry since his debut, notably with the success of his recent deluxe album, Unreal Unearth, featuring hits like Too Sweet.

His consistent chart presence and critical acclaim underline his evolution and enduring impact in the music industry.

Anniversary Edition Tracklist

Side A:

  • Take Me To Church
  • Angel of Small Death & The Codeine Scene
  • Jackie and Wilson
  • Someone New
  • To Be Alone

Side B:

  • From Eden
  • In A Week
  • Sedated
  • Work Song

Side C:

  • Like Real People Do
  • It Will Come Back
  • Foreigner’s Gold
  • Cherry Wine (Live)

Side D:

  • In The Woods Somewhere
  • Run
  • Arsonist’s Lullabye
  • My Love Will Never Die
